School Holidays in September: Heavy monsoon showers have once again brought life to a standstill in parts of Maharashtra. With Mumbai and Pune facing intense rainfall, waterlogging, and traffic jams, parents are anxious about whether schools will remain open this week. The India Meteorological Department (IMD) has issued Orange and Red alerts, putting students’ safety in focus.

At present, there is no blanket holiday across Maharashtra. However, in Pune’s Hadapsar and nearby areas, several schools have declared a holiday for September 15, 2025, due to waterlogging. In Mumbai, the Brihanmumbai Municipal Corporation (BMC) has not issued any closure notice so far.
Situation in Mumbai and Pune
City | Weather Alert | Current Status (Sept 15) | Next Update |
|---|---|---|---|
Mumbai | Orange Alert | Schools open, localized waterlogging | Based on IMD morning report (Sept 16) |
Pune | Red Alert | Schools closed in Hadapsar & nearby areas | Decision for Sept 16 pending |
Will Schools Be Closed Tomorrow?
- Pune: Schools are shut for September 15 only. Any decision for September 16 will depend on overnight rainfall and official advisories.
- Mumbai: Schools remain open, but parents should watch for early morning circulars or WhatsApp updates from schools.

Other States Facing Disruptions
Apart from Maharashtra, these states also witnessed weather-related school holidays in September 2025:
State | Reason for Closure | Duration |
|---|---|---|
Punjab | Flooding in low-lying areas | 1-2 days |
Rajasthan | Heavy rainfall, blocked highways | 1 day |
Jammu & Kashmir | Landslides after rain | District-wise closures |
